Hotel franchising company Wyndham Hotels & Resorts has continued its global expansion with a debut in the mountainous country of Nepal through its 90-room hotel Ramada Encore.

Unveiled earlier this week, Ramada Encore by Wyndham Kathmandu-Thamel is situated in the centre of Nepal’s capital Kathmandu and is part of the city’s commercial centre rejuvenation project.

The hotel is claimed to be among Nepal’s top attractions and cultural wonders, such as Mount Everest’s base camp, the Garden of Dreams, and Kathmandu Durbar Square’s Ason Bazaar.

With over 50 properties in the Indian sub-continent, Ramada Encore forms another milestone towards Wyndham’s expansion plans.

Wyndham Hotels & Resorts Eurasia regional director Nikhil Sharma said: “We are thrilled to be expanding Wyndham’s portfolio in this exciting new destination. Nepal is a beautiful country with huge potential and we are pleased to be making our footprint as part of our strategy to further expand our EMEA reach across the Indian sub-continent.

“With a growing portfolio of more than 50 operational hotels in the region and plans to develop around 30 additional properties across India, Bhutan, Bangladesh and Pakistan by 2025, the debut of the Ramada Encore by Wyndham brand brings us one step closer to our mission of making hotel travel possible for all in the Indian sub-continent and beyond.”

The newly-built Ramada Encore by Wyndham Kathmandu-Thamel has been built keeping in mind easy accessibility for guests, who can sit back and enjoy the contemporary designs of the comfortable rooms.

On-site food and beverage outlets of the hotel include the outdoor El Beso Caro, which offers scenic views of the city, while the Ramada Encore’s rooftop plunge pool, spa, salon and fitness centre promise to offer rejuvenation and relaxation.

Wyndham Hotels & Resorts has approximately 9,000 hotels across 90 countries.
